The Global Certificate Course in Environmental Economics and Sustainability is a critical qualification for professionals navigating today’s rapidly evolving market. With the UK government committing to achieving net-zero emissions by 2050, the demand for expertise in environmental economics and sustainability has surged. According to recent data, the UK’s green economy grew by 9% in 2022, contributing £71 billion to the GDP, and employs over 1.2 million people. This growth underscores the need for professionals equipped with advanced knowledge in sustainable practices and economic frameworks.
Year Green Economy Contribution (£bn) Employment (millions)
2021 65 1.1
2022 71 1.2

Career path

Environmental Economist

Analyze economic data to develop policies for sustainable resource management and environmental protection.

Sustainability Consultant

Advise organizations on reducing environmental impact and implementing sustainable practices.

Climate Policy Analyst

Evaluate and recommend policies to mitigate climate change and promote renewable energy adoption.

Green Finance Specialist

Develop financial strategies to support eco-friendly projects and sustainable investments.
